For cash-based businesses, meticulous recordkeeping is essential. Because cash transactions are harder to verify, they increase the risk of underreporting income and attracting IRS scrutiny. The IRS closely monitors such businesses, using tools like cash flow analysis, bank deposit comparisons and lifestyle audits to estimate actual income. The Social Security Administration said that Social Security benefits for 2026, including Old-Age, Survivors, and Disability Insurance (OASDI), and Supplemental Security Income (SSI) payments, will increase 2.8%. These changes reflect cost-of-living adjustments based on inflation. Social Security retirement benefits will increase by about $56 per month on average starting in January. Increased payments to SSI recipients will begin on Dec. 31, 2025. (Note: Some people receive both Social Security benefits and SSI.) The maximum earnings subject to Social Security tax (the so-called “wage base”) will increase $8,400, from $176,100 to $184,500. Have questions about the Social Security tax? A revocable trust (sometimes known as a “living trust”) can provide significant benefits. They include the ability to avoid probate for the assets the trust holds and to facilitate the management of your assets in the event you become incapacitated. To obtain these benefits, you must fund the trust by transferring the title of assets to it. Assets not held by your revocable trust may be subject to probate and will be beyond the trustee’s control in the event you become incapacitated. Did you receive an IRS audit notice but believe you did nothing wrong? Some audits are random, and some can be resolved by mail. Others are triggered by red flags that may put the IRS spotlight on your tax return. Keeping up with ever-evolving tax laws can be challenging, but one common red flag that may draw attention is a sudden, unexplained spike or drop in your reported income from one year to the next. The IRS has issued transitional guidance to auto lenders required to report certain vehicle loan interest for 2025. Under the tax legislation signed into law in July, interest on qualified passenger vehicle loans originated after Dec. 31, 2024, generally is deductible up to $10,000. Lenders must provide eligible taxpayers with the appropriate information to claim the deduction on their 2025 tax returns. According to the guidance, the IRS will consider that lenders have met their reporting obligations for interest received on a qualified vehicle loan in 2025 if they make statements available to buyers indicating the total amount of interest received.
